DyLight® fluorophores have absorption maxima covering the entire visible light spectrum (350 nm to 777 nm), as well several key near-infrared and infrared wavelengths. Both the absorption and emission properties of the DyLight® fluorophores match the excitation and detection wavelengths of common fluorescence instrumentation used for immunocytochemistry, immunohistochemistry, and flow cytometry. The DyLight® fluorophores exhibit higher fluorescence intensity and photostability than Alexa Fluor, CyDye and LI-COR Dyes in many applications and remain highly fluorescent over a broad pH range (pH 4-9). Additionally, the water solubility of the DyLight® fluorophores allows a high dye-to-protein ratio to be achieved without causing precipitation of conjugates. These favorable properties and high anisotropy value, as well as a high cross-section for two-photon excitation, make these fluorophores attractive as fluorescent probes in a variety of fluorescence methods.

The DyLight® 650-conjugated goat polyclonal secondary reagent reacts with the heavy chains of rabbit IgG, and the light chains of most rabbit immunoglobulins.

Goat polyclonal antibody is supplied in phosphate-buffered saline, 50% glycerol, 1 mg/ml BSA and 0.05% sodium azide. Store at –20°C. Stable for 1 year.

The products are are safely shipped at ambient temperature for both domestic and international shipments. Each product is guaranteed to match the specifications as indicated on the corresponding technical data sheet. Please store at -20C upon arrival for long term storage.

This antibody has been affinity-purified using rabbit IgG coupled to agarose beads. Purified goat polyclonal antibody was conjugated to DyLight® 650 fluorophore (Excitation = 654 nm; Emission = 673 nm). This secondary reagent can be used to detect rabbit immunoglobulins in various immunofluorescence applications, such as immunocytochemistry, immunohistochemistry, fluorescent western blotting, and flow cytometry.
